What's the average time to fill an event manager role?

The average time to fill an event manager role is 52 days, calculated from the moment the job is posted until a candidate accepts the offer.

What licenses or certifications are common for an event manager?

Common licenses or certifications for event managers include: Driver's License, Servsafe and Food Safety Certification.
